my overclocked gpu (GeForce Go 7400) core and memory speeds drop down to 125/300 from 523/850 when using these drivers.

any help would be appreciated?

PS: i'm using vistax86

Edited by dgr8one
Link to comment
Share on other sites

1)does it drop down in gaming?

2)Or are you checking the clock speeds when not gaming? (in desktop srufing the net for example)

if its 1= gpu downclocks itself due to avoid damage

2= normal powermizer feature to save power and heat.
